Channel 77
Channel 77 has been used to refer to:
* An Australian digital television channel used by Seven Network to broadcast TV listings, news and weather.
* A local cable channel, "The City of Miami Television" in Miami, Florida
* A former NTSC-M channel, removed from television use in 1983 and originally used by stations in North America which broadcast on 848-854 MHz. In the United States, channels 70-83 were rarely used and served primarily as a "translator band" of small repeater transmitters rebroadcasting existing stations:
* KTVX-TV (ABC Salt Lake City) rebroadcaster K77AJ Delta, Utah was moved to K35GC channel 35.
* KGUN (ABC Tucson) rebroadcaster K77BX Casas Adobes, Arizona is now K02BW channel 2.
